Exploring Mumbai: A 6-Day Adventure

Tuesday, October 10: Arrival in Mumbai

Welcome to Mumbai, the bustling metropolis on the western coast of India! After settling into your hotel, begin your Mumbai adventure with a visit to the iconic Gateway of India. Marvel at its grand architecture and take a leisurely stroll along the waterfront promenade, enjoying the views of the Arabian Sea. In the afternoon, explore the historic Colaba neighborhood, known for its vibrant street markets and quaint cafes. As the evening sets in, head to Marine Drive, also known as the Queen's Necklace, and witness the stunning sunset.

  • Gateway of India: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Colaba Neighborhood: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Marine Drive: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Wednesday, October 11: Exploring South Mumbai

Begin your day with a visit to the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its stunning blend of Victorian Gothic and traditional Indian architecture. Explore the fascinating exhibits at the nearby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Vastu Sangrahalaya, the main art and history museum of Mumbai.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of Crawford Market, a bustling bazaar where you can find a variety of goods. End your day by visiting the iconic Haji Ali Dargah, a beautiful mosque located in the middle of the Arabian Sea.

  •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Vastu Sangrahalaya: Cost - INR 500 (approx.),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Crawford Market: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Haji Ali Dargah: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Thursday, October 12: Unveiling the Heritage

Explore the historic side of Mumbai by visiting Elephanta Caves, a UNESCO World Heritage Site located on Elephanta Island. Marvel at the intricate rock-cut caves, adorned with ancient sculptures and carvings. Take a ferry ride to the island and spend your afternoon exploring the caves and enjoying the panoramic views. Return to the city and visit the iconic Chor Bazaar, a treasure trove of antiques, vintage items, and unique finds. End your day with a traditional Bollywood movie experience at one of Mumbai's famous cinemas.

  • Elephanta Caves: Cost - Ferry - INR 200 (approx.), Entry - INR 40 (approx.), Time Spent - 4-5 hours
  • Chor Bazaar: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Bollywood Movie: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Friday, October 13: Modern Marvels

Start your day by visiting the Bandra-Worli Sea Link, an architectural marvel that connects the suburbs of Bandra and Worli. Enjoy the panoramic views of the city and the Arabian Sea from this iconic bridge. Afterward, explore the vibrant Bandra neighborhood, known for its trendy cafes, street art, and vibrant nightlife. In the afternoon, visit the Nehru Science Centre, an interactive museum that offers exciting exhibits and educational experiences. As the evening approaches, head to Juhu Beach and indulge in delicious street food while enjoying the sunset.

  • Bandra-Worli Sea Link: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Bandra Neighborhood: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Nehru Science Centre: Cost - INR 100 (approx.),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Juhu Beach: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day, October 14: Bazaars and Beaches

Experience the vibrant markets of Mumbai by starting your day at the colorful Dadar Flower Market, where you can witness the hustle and bustle of flower vendors and soak in the fragrant atmosphere. Explore the nearby Dadar Parsi Colony, known for its beautiful architecture and Parsi community. In the afternoon, visit the bustling markets of Linking Road in Bandra, known for its trendy fashion boutiques and street shopping. End your day by relaxing at the serene and picturesque Versova Beach.

  • Dadar Flower Market: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Dadar Parsi Colony: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Linking Road Market: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Versova Beach: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Sunday, October 15: Cultural Immersion

Immerse yourself in Mumbai's rich culture by starting your day with a visit to the iconic Siddhivinayak Temple, a renowned Hindu temple dedicated to Lord Ganesha. Explore the vibrant Worli Village, known for its street art and traditional pottery. In the afternoon, visit the Dr. Bhau Daji Lad Museum, the oldest museum in Mumbai, and admire its impressive collection of art and artifacts. End your trip on a high note by enjoying a traditional Maharashtrian thali for dinner, complete with delectable regional delicacies.

  • Siddhivinayak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Worli Village: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Dr. Bhau Daji Lad Museum: Cost - INR 100 (approx.),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Traditional Maharashtrian Thali: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 1-2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ring Mumbai, don't miss the opportunity to visit the hidden gems and experience local favorites. Take a walk through the vibrant Kala Ghoda Art Precinct, filled with art galleries, museums, and charming cafes. Visit the serene and picturesque Powai Lake, where you can enjoy boating and peaceful surroundings. Indulge in Mumbai's street food culture by trying the famous Vada Pav, Pav Bhaji, and Pani Puri. Explore the lively markets of Dadar and experience the authentic local shopping scene. These off the beaten path attractions and local favorites will add a unique and memorable touch to your Mumbai adventure.
